Power Management ICs (PMICs) play an essential role in the efficient operating of electronic devices by providing Voltage regulated DC power rails to the device. The TOP246GN-TL is an off-line switching-mode power supply controller that integrates a variety of functional blocks in one package to reduce the number of external components and provide the basis for an efficient power supply. This device provides a cost-effective, reliable and easy-to-design solution for a wide range of AC-DC and DC-DC converters.
The TOP246GN-TL is well-suited for use in applications with low power levels such as LED drivers, Standby power supplies, Small battery chargers and Motor drives. It can also be used in AC/DC power adapters, LCD TV/ monitors and telecom power supplies.
